Open Lighting Architecture
0.9.0
|
This is the complete list of members for ola::io::IOQueue, including all inherited members.
AppendBlock(class MemoryBlock *block) | ola::io::IOQueue | |
AsIOVec(int *io_count) const | ola::io::IOQueue | virtual |
Clear() | ola::io::IOQueue | |
Dump(std::ostream *output) | ola::io::IOQueue | |
Empty() const (defined in ola::io::IOQueue) | ola::io::IOQueue | inlinevirtual |
FreeIOVec(const struct iovec *iov) (defined in ola::io::IOVecInterface) | ola::io::IOVecInterface | inlinestatic |
IOQueue() | ola::io::IOQueue | |
IOQueue(class MemoryBlockPool *block_pool) (defined in ola::io::IOQueue) | ola::io::IOQueue | explicit |
Peek(uint8_t *data, unsigned int length) const | ola::io::IOQueue | |
Pop(unsigned int n) | ola::io::IOQueue | virtual |
Purge() (defined in ola::io::IOQueue) | ola::io::IOQueue | |
Read(uint8_t *data, unsigned int length) | ola::io::IOQueue | virtual |
Read(std::string *output, unsigned int length) | ola::io::IOQueue | virtual |
Size() const | ola::io::IOQueue | virtual |
Write(const uint8_t *data, unsigned int length) | ola::io::IOQueue | virtual |
~InputBufferInterface() (defined in ola::io::InputBufferInterface) | ola::io::InputBufferInterface | inlinevirtual |
~IOQueue() | ola::io::IOQueue | |
~IOVecInterface() (defined in ola::io::IOVecInterface) | ola::io::IOVecInterface | inlinevirtual |
~OutputBufferInterface() (defined in ola::io::OutputBufferInterface) | ola::io::OutputBufferInterface | inlinevirtual |